Claude Guéant will return to court.
The former minister will soon be tried in Nanterre for "illicit financing" of his legislative campaign in 2012, because of the distribution of a leaflet in his favor by the mayor LR of Boulogne-Billancourt (Hauts-de-Seine), a AFP learned Monday from a source close to the case.
The key man of the presidency Sarkozy, aged 76, must also be tried for "fraud for the reimbursement of his campaign expenses".
